|
@@ -13,19 +13,6 @@ import java.util.stream.Collectors;
|
|
import javax.transaction.Transactional;
|
|
import javax.transaction.Transactional;
|
|
|
|
|
|
import org.apache.commons.lang3.StringUtils;
|
|
import org.apache.commons.lang3.StringUtils;
|
|
-import org.examcloud.core.reports.api.ExamCourseDataReportCloudService;
|
|
|
|
-import org.examcloud.core.reports.api.ExamOrgReportCloudService;
|
|
|
|
-import org.examcloud.core.reports.api.ProjectCloudService;
|
|
|
|
-import org.examcloud.core.reports.api.bean.ExamCourseDataReportBean;
|
|
|
|
-import org.examcloud.core.reports.api.bean.ExamOrgReportBean;
|
|
|
|
-import org.examcloud.core.reports.api.bean.ProjectInfoBean;
|
|
|
|
-import org.examcloud.core.reports.api.request.DeleteExamCourseDataReportByProjectReq;
|
|
|
|
-import org.examcloud.core.reports.api.request.DeleteExamOrgReportByProjectReq;
|
|
|
|
-import org.examcloud.core.reports.api.request.GetProjectInfoBeanReq;
|
|
|
|
-import org.examcloud.core.reports.api.request.SaveExamCourseDataReportListReq;
|
|
|
|
-import org.examcloud.core.reports.api.request.SaveExamOrgReportListReq;
|
|
|
|
-import org.examcloud.core.reports.api.request.UpdateProjectStatusReq;
|
|
|
|
-import org.examcloud.core.reports.api.response.GetProjectInfoBeanResp;
|
|
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
import org.springframework.beans.factory.annotation.Autowired;
|
|
import org.springframework.stereotype.Service;
|
|
import org.springframework.stereotype.Service;
|
|
|
|
|
|
@@ -34,6 +21,19 @@ import cn.com.qmth.examcloud.core.oe.admin.api.bean.ExamStudentDataBean;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.bean.ExamStudentScoreDataBean;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.bean.ExamStudentScoreDataBean;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.request.GetExamStudentDataReq;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.request.GetExamStudentDataReq;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.response.GetExamStudentDataResp;
|
|
import cn.com.qmth.examcloud.core.oe.admin.api.response.GetExamStudentDataResp;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.ExamCourseDataReportCloudService;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.ExamOrgReportCloudService;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.ProjectCloudService;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.bean.ExamCourseDataReportBean;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.bean.ExamOrgReportBean;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.bean.ProjectInfoBean;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.DeleteExamCourseDataReportByProjectRe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.DeleteExamOrgReportByProjectRe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.GetProjectInfoBeanRe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.SaveExamCourseDataReportListRe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.SaveExamOrgReportListRe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.request.UpdateProjectStatusReq;
|
|
|
|
+import cn.com.qmth.examcloud.core.reports.api.response.GetProjectInfoBeanResp;
|
|
import cn.com.qmth.examcloud.task.dao.ReportsComputeRepo;
|
|
import cn.com.qmth.examcloud.task.dao.ReportsComputeRepo;
|
|
import cn.com.qmth.examcloud.task.dao.entity.ReportsComputeEntity;
|
|
import cn.com.qmth.examcloud.task.dao.entity.ReportsComputeEntity;
|
|
import cn.com.qmth.examcloud.task.dao.enums.ReportsComputeStatus;
|
|
import cn.com.qmth.examcloud.task.dao.enums.ReportsComputeStatus;
|
|
@@ -53,7 +53,7 @@ public class ReportsComputeServiceImpl implements ReportsComputeService {
|
|
@Autowired
|
|
@Autowired
|
|
private ProjectCloudService projectCloudService;
|
|
private ProjectCloudService projectCloudService;
|
|
|
|
|
|
-// @Autowired
|
|
|
|
|
|
+ @Autowired
|
|
private ExamStudentDataCloudService examStudentDataCloudService;
|
|
private ExamStudentDataCloudService examStudentDataCloudService;
|
|
|
|
|
|
@Autowired
|
|
@Autowired
|